Summary

The United States Men’s National Team secured a victory over Bosnia and Herzegovina on July 2, 2026, advancing to the Round of 16 in the World Cup. The match saw USMNT play the final 30 minutes with 10 players after Folarin Balogun received a questionable red card. Malik Tillman scored a crucial free kick in the 82nd minute, which proved vital for the team's success. After the game, Landon Donovan, working for Fox Sports, humorously remarked that he nearly lost his fake hair from the stress of the tense moments late in the match.
